Analysis

Benin recorded 5,200 for children (0-14) living with hiv in 2024.

The figure is down 7.1% on the previous year and down 45.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, children (0-14) living with hiv in Benin peaked at 10,000 in 2006 and was at its lowest, 550, in 1990.

That places Benin 32nd out of 88 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
